RESUMO
The retrolabyrinthine approach was described several years ago, however its use was restricted to functional surgery of the cerebellopontine angle. Its detractors reproach its narrowness. But a large approach to the cerbellopontine angle can be performed after an extended exposure of the posterior and middle fossa dura, and section of the endolymphatic sac. This approach was used in 5 cases of acoustic neurinomas stage I and II, with normal hearing. Hearing preservation was obtained in 2 cases. We had deafness in 2 cases who had extensive tumor in the bottom of the internal auditory canal.
